Key Metrics to Mine

First, focus on head‑to‑head records. A team that dominates another over ten meetings isn’t just lucky; it enjoys a tactical advantage. Second, examine home‑field performance. Rugby isn’t a neutral sport; crowds, weather, and turf type shift the odds dramatically. Third, track penalty differentials. Teams that consistently concede fewer penalties often translate discipline into points. Fourth, player injury histories. A star’s recurring absences can erode a side’s firepower, and the odds rarely adjust fast enough.

Time Frames Matter

Don’t lump five‑year data with five‑day data. Recent form carries weight, but long‑term consistency reveals reliability. Slice the dataset: last 5 games for momentum, last 12 months for seasonal trends, last 5 years for structural strengths. Blend them like a cocktail—too much of any one slice skews perception.

Cleaning the Noise

Here is the deal: raw data is messy. Duplicate entries, missing values, and outliers can sabotage your model. Strip out matches with extreme weather anomalies unless they’re part of a recurring pattern. Normalize figures to per‑match values, not aggregate totals. After cleaning, the dataset becomes a reliable engine for prediction.

Building a Simple Predictive Model

Start with a logistic regression that predicts win probability based on three variables: head‑to‑head win rate, home advantage index, and average penalty margin. Feed the cleaned dataset, let the algorithm spit out coefficients, then apply those to upcoming fixtures. No need for neural networks unless you love complexity. The model’s strength lies in transparency, not opacity.

Testing the Model

Back‑test on last season’s results. If your model correctly identifies 65‑70% of winners, you’re in the sweet spot. Adjust thresholds if false positives creep in. Remember, a model isn’t sacred; it evolves with the sport.

Putting the Edge into Action

When a match approaches, pull the latest odds, overlay your model’s probability, and spot the divergence. If your predicted win chance exceeds the bookmaker’s implied probability by 5% or more, that’s a betting signal. Stake size should reflect confidence, but never exceed a disciplined bankroll percentage.
